KNF NPK09 Series Oscillating Piston Gas Pump
Compact yet delivers high performance with a maximum pressure of 7 barG and a robust design.
- Transport of liquid and gas samples for analysis - Medical technology - such as inhalation devices - Vacuum technology - such as chucking Basic flow rate: 12 - 24 l/min ~ Achievable vacuum level: < 100 mbar abs ~ Maximum allowable discharge pressure: 7 bar (0.7 MPa)

Reasons why diaphragm pumps in food inspection equipment contribute to ensuring food safety.
KNF diaphragm pumps play a crucial role in ensuring the quality and safety of food products such as dairy and wine. The Importance of Food Inspection Food inspection is essential for several reasons. It identifies contaminants that may be present in food and ensures that the food is safe for consumption. It also verifies the accuracy of nutritional labeling, which is very important for consumers who rely on this information to make dietary choices. Furthermore, food inspection supports regulatory compliance, helping manufacturers meet industry standards and avoid legal issues. For these reasons, the food industry relies on inspection equipment, such as analytical devices, to ensure that product quality standards are consistently met.

Customizable piston pump: The key to effective shockwave therapy.
The KNF NPK swing piston pump enables medical device manufacturers to accurately control pressure in compact shock wave therapy devices, enhancing the treatment effects for musculoskeletal disorders and other conditions through shock wave stimulation. The latest extracorporeal shock wave therapy (ESWT) devices generate pressure waves precisely for effective treatment of a wide range of diseases. At the core of this technology, the KNF NPK piston pump provides the stable pressure generation and precise control required by medical device manufacturers. High-pressure pumps realize advanced shock wave therapy, which is an innovative medical treatment method that generates radial or focused shock waves using specialized equipment.

Diaphragm pumps support the future of dental treatment with lasers.
The KNF gas pump plays an important role in laser dental treatment. It is used to generate compressed air, which is mixed with water to produce a spray mist. This mist helps to cool the oral area during treatment. Both the NPK 09 and NPK 09.1.2 are essential to this process. These swing piston gas pumps are oil-free, have a high performance-to-size ratio, and are highly reliable. The flow rates are 15 l/min and 24 l/min respectively, with a maximum pressure of 7 bar (gauge pressure) for both pumps. Liquid diaphragm pumps also play an important role in laser dental treatment. Pumps like the FMM 20 are typically used to cool the laser with deionized water. The FMM 20 is designed for dry running, is self-priming, and is maintenance-free. Its maximum flow rate is 0.018 l/min, maximum pressure is 1 bar (gauge), and maximum suction height is 3 mH20.
